Cleaning methods for blankets

1. How to wash coral fleece blanket

The raw material for producing coral fleece blankets is imported ultra-fine fibers. Coral fleece has a soft and smooth surface, delicate hand feel, and good water absorption, making it very easy to clean. It can be directly washed with water without causing discoloration, shedding, pilling, and other phenomena. It is commonly used in baby home textile products, children's clothing, craft products, and other fields in daily life. The cleaning methods for coral fleece blankets are divided into machine washing and hand washing. It should be noted that after cleaning, they should be naturally dried and not ironed.

2. How to wash pure wool blankets

Pure wool blankets have a special material and weak fiber structure, so hand washing is generally the best method. High speed washing machines should not be used for cleaning to avoid damaging the fiber structure of pure wool blankets, causing deformation and damage. When hand washing a pure wool blanket, first immerse the blanket in warm water to fully wet it, then press out the water, apply soap or other detergent to the surface of the blanket, and gently rub it with your hands. After cleaning, pure wool blankets should not be exposed to direct sunlight and should be dried in a well ventilated and cool place.

3. How to wash synthetic blankets

Fiber based blankets are mainly made of acrylic and polyester materials, which are the most common types of blankets in households nowadays. What we often refer to as Raschel blankets is acrylic blankets. Fiber based blankets should be washed with cold water at a temperature of 20 ° C as much as possible. When choosing detergent products, neutral and non corrosive products should be selected. Hot water should not be used for ironing. After washing, the treatment method is similar to that of wool blankets. Do not expose them to sunlight or iron them, and let them air dry naturally.

Can blankets be washed in a washing machine

Generally speaking, regardless of the material of the blanket, we recommend hand washing it because the spinning of the washing machine can cause the fiber structure of the blanket to be damaged, resulting in deformation and hardening of the blanket, seriously damaging its service life. Nowadays, blanket products on the market generally have clear washing labels, and people can choose the cleaning method according to their actual situation. For products that require hand washing, if there is no time, they can be sent to a dry cleaner for cleaning.
